Updated Operational Situation Overview - November 10, 2024 (as of 02:18 UTC)
Key Developments:
UAV Activity Intensification:
Surveillance confirms the presence of UAV threats, particularly from Rivna moving towards Kyiv. Shahed drones are detected in various regions, including Zhytomyr, Poltava, and now reported moving towards Starokostyantyniv in Khmelnytskyi region. The trajectory indicates a broader coordinated offensive targeting urban and critical infrastructure.
Airstrike Threats to Kyiv:
Reports confirm air raid alerts in Kyiv are ongoing as enemy UAVs approach. Civilians are urged to seek shelter immediately. The imminent threat to urban safety necessitates the prioritization of air defense systems.
Combat Engagements:
Ukrainian forces remain active against identified Russian units, particularly around Selidovo and Kurakhove. Engagements show confirmed Ukrainian artillery strikes on enemy logistics, while significant troop movements by Russian forces necessitate careful counteroffensive planning.
